嵌入式项目合作-嵌入式项目合作
嵌入式项目合作是现代科技产业中极具活力的领域,它连接着硬件制造、软件开发、系统集成与最终用户等多个环节。
随着物联网、人工智能及大数据技术的飞速发展,嵌入式系统已不再局限于简单的元器件封装,而是演变为万物互联的核心枢纽。在复杂的工程实践中,选择合适的合作伙伴、明确责任边界以及建立高效的沟通机制,是项目成功的关键所在。本文将以实际案例为支撑,结合行业最佳实践,深入剖析嵌入式项目合作的全方位攻略,旨在帮助从业者规避常见风险,提升交付品质。

明确需求:合作成功的基石
嵌入式系统的设计往往涉及极端的性能约束,如功耗限制、实时性要求及空间紧凑性,因此,需求定义的清晰度直接决定了后续合作的成败。许多项目因需求模糊导致“先天不足”,即便硬件架构完美也无法达到预期效果。在合作初期,必须通过详尽的需求文档(PRD)将业务目标、功能需求、性能指标及非功能需求(如响应时间、内存占用、屏幕亮度等)量化。
于此同时呢,应特别关注用户体验的边界,例如在工业场景中需明确安全报警的响应阈值,在消费级产品中需界定智能化交互的便捷程度。
除了这些以外呢,用户反馈的渠道选择也至关重要,应涵盖现场巡检、远程监控及售后服务等多个维度,确保需求闭环。
在实际操作中,需求变更的管理更是重中之重。由于外部环境或技术成熟度的变化,需求调整在所难免,但合理的变更流程能避免项目失控。一般建议采用“冻结期 + 变更申请”机制,在项目开发关键节点前锁定核心参数,后续变更需经过量化评估与成本核算。有经验的团队会建立变更影响分析模型,评估变更对项目进度、成本及最终质量的具体影响,并制定相应的补偿或调整方案,确保各方利益在变更过程中得到平衡与保障。
硬件选型与环境适配:决定产品寿命的关键
硬件选型是嵌入式项目合作的起点,其选择直接关系到系统的稳定性、扩展性及后续维护成本。目前主流的芯片选型策略包括:根据应用领域选择成熟可靠的工业级芯片,适用于恶劣环境;根据性能指标选择高频响应或低延迟特性的专用芯片;或采用通用型芯片并辅以软件优化手段。选型时还需充分考虑芯片的可靠性认证情况,如通过 IEC 62301 等标准测试,以符合相关法规要求。
在电路设计环节,电源管理方案同样关键。许多项目因供电不足导致系统频繁中断,或出现电压不稳造成数据丢失。建议采用多级稳压设计,结合电池备份与能量收集技术,提升系统的容灾能力。
于此同时呢,散热设计不能忽视,特别是在长时间运行的户外或工业设备中,合理的 PCB 布局与热管、风冷组合能提供长久保障。
除了这些以外呢,通信协议的兼容性也是选型时的重点,需确保所选芯片支持多种主流接口(如 CAN、LIN、I2C、USB 等),以适应多样化的应用场景。
硬件环境的适配要求极高,需根据现场温度、湿度、电磁干扰(EMI)及机械振动等因素进行专项测试与优化。特别是在汽车电子领域,需满足 ISO 26262 功能安全标准;在航空航天领域,则需遵循特定的认证流程。通过模拟测试与实地验证,提前发现并解决潜在的热失效、信号漂移等问题,是确保产品长期稳定运行的核心环节。
软件开发与系统集成:技术落地的核心
软件开发在嵌入式项目中占据重要地位,旨在实现硬件与业务的深度结合。现代嵌入式软件开发强调实时操作系统(RTOS)的应用,如 FreeRTOS、QNX 等,以解决多任务调度与中断处理问题。代码编写需遵循统一的编码规范,确保可读性与可维护性。模块化设计应优先采用分层架构,清晰划分感知层、网络层、控制层与数据层,便于后续功能扩展与调试。
同时,系统集成是连接硬件与业务的桥梁。合作中需明确接口定义,提供标准化的通信协议文档与调试工具,降低联调难度。特别是在网络通信方面,需确保数据加密传输,保障信息安全,并实现与云端平台的无缝对接。数据日志的采集与分析能力也是系统集成的另一个重要方面,通过结构化存储与可视化展示,为运维提供决策依据。
软件的生命周期管理必须贯穿始终,涵盖需求分析、设计、编码、测试与部署。在测试阶段,应采用自动化测试与人工测试相结合的策略,覆盖功能测试、性能测试及可靠性测试等多个维度。对于复杂系统,还需进行压力测试与故障注入测试,模拟极端情况下的系统表现,确保其在各种干扰下依然稳定运行。
除了这些以外呢,文档编制与知识沉淀也是软件交付的重要组成部分,应形成完整的用户手册与运维手册,赋能后续维护人员。
项目管理与风险管控:保障项目进度的加速器
嵌入式项目周期长、变量多,项目管理显得尤为关键。有效的沟通机制是项目顺利推进的保障,建议建立跨职能的联合工作组,包括项目经理、硬件工程师、软件工程师及测试工程师,定期召开同步会议,及时同步进度、风险与资源需求。建立透明的项目看板,利用看板或协作工具实时监控任务执行情况,确保信息流转高效。
风险管控需具备前瞻性,应识别技术、供应链、法规及市场等方面的潜在风险,并制定相应的预案。对于技术风险,可通过原型验证与多轮迭代来降低不确定性;对于供应链风险,可申请多源采购策略,确保核心元器件供应稳定;对于法规风险,应密切关注行业政策变化,及时调整技术路线。
除了这些以外呢,还应引入第三方监理或质量评估机构,对关键节点进行独立审计,提升整体质量水平。
在应对风险时,应保持灵活性与敏捷性,制定快速响应机制。当遇到突发状况时,应迅速评估影响范围,协调各方资源进行快速攻关,避免问题扩大化。
于此同时呢,要将风险管理作为常规工作的一部分,定期复盘,不断优化风险识别与应对策略,构建起坚韧的项目管理体系。
团队建设与人才培养:驱动项目持续发展的动力
优秀的嵌入式项目往往依托于一支高素质、高凝聚力的团队。团队结构应合理配置,确保硬件、软件、测试及项目管理各角色职责分明、协同高效。团队成员应具备丰富的实战经验,既懂底层原理,又通晓上层应用,具备解决复杂问题的能力。定期举办技术分享会、代码审查及技术培训,有助于提升团队整体技术水平与协作意识。
人才培养是团队可持续发展的核心。鼓励年轻工程师参与核心模块开发,通过轮岗锻炼与导师制指导,加速成长。建立知识共享平台,鼓励优秀代码与经验文档的沉淀与传播,避免重复造轮子。
于此同时呢,关注团队成员的职业发展与心理状态,提供良好的工作氛围与激励机制,增强团队归属感,激发创新活力。
在合作过程中,应注重建立长期战略合作关系,通过联合创新、技术攻关等形式深化彼此联系。这种基于信任与互信的合作模式,能够在新项目启动前就奠定坚实基础,为未来的多次合作创造良好条件。通过持续的技术交流与创新共生,推动整个嵌入式项目生态的繁荣发展。

,嵌入式项目合作是一个系统工程,始于精准的需求定义,成于卓越的硬件选型与软件实施,过程中需严格的项目管理与风险管控,并依托优秀的团队建设与人才开发。唯有统筹兼顾各方因素,制定科学合理的合作策略,方能确保嵌入式项目按时、保质交付,实现商业价值与社会效益的双赢,推动行业技术水平的持续提升。
注意事项:
部分资源可能会出现广告/收费服务/VIP课程等内容,请自行甄别,以免上当受骗。
本篇资源由【小木应用文】收集自互联网,仅供学习参考使用,请勿用于其他用途!
转载请标明出处,谢谢。